PEG/PPG-8/3 Laurate

PEG/PPG-8/3 Laurate is a cosmetic ingredient used as a surfactant - emulsifying, emulsion stabilising agent. It is used in 10 products in our dataset. It is regulated in the EU (listed in a Cosmetics Regulation annex).
